In this episode of Talking Crit, hosts Stubbii and Gygis return to dive deeper into the growing mystery of Critical Role Campaign 4.
Following the emotional weight of The Fall of Thjazi Fang, Broken Wing pulls back the curtain on the world of Aramán — where grief, faith, and power collide in unexpected ways.
Echoes of rebellion resurface, uneasy alliances begin to form, and secrets long buried start to stir. With new faces stepping into the light and old scars refusing to heal, this chapter reminds us that every victory comes at a cost.
